Elements Influencing Headset Prices
The price of a headset can vary substantially based on numerous elements. Comprehending these aspects can help customers make informed options when purchasing headsets.
1. Innovation and Features
Headsets come geared up with a plethora of functions that can considerably affect their rates. Typical technological developments consist of:
- Noise Cancellation: Active noise cancellation (ANC) technology is typically found in higher-end designs. This function improves audio quality by reducing background noise.
- Wireless vs. Wired: Wireless headsets usually command higher costs due to the technology associated with Bluetooth or other wireless connections.
- Audio Quality: Brands that highlight high-definition sound quality frequently price their products higher. Studio-quality headsets, for instance, offer more accurate audio fidelity than basic models.
- Microphone Quality: For gamers and professionals, the quality of the microphone incorporated into headsets can significantly affect functionality and, subsequently, rates.
2. Brand name Reputation
Developed brand names like Bose, Sony, and Sennheiser typically have higher price points since of their track record for quality and dependability, whereas lesser-known brands might offer less expensive options that do not have certain functions or toughness.
3. Products and Build Quality
The materials used in construction can contribute considerably to a headset's price. High-end designs might utilize premium plastics, metals, and other durable materials that not only enhance comfort however likewise increase longevity.

5. Type of Headset
Various kinds of headsets serve numerous functions and include their particular price ranges:
Type of Headset | Price Range (GBP) | Typical Use |
---|---|---|
Basic Wired Headset | 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 | Casual listening |
Gaming Headsets | ₤ 50 - ₤ 300 | Video gaming environments |
Noise-Cancelling Headsets | ₤ 100 - ₤ 400 | Travel and work environments |
Studio Headphones | ₤ 100 - ₤ 800+ | Professional audio production |
Real Wireless Earbuds | ₤ 50 - ₤ 300 | Everyday use and convenience |

FAQs About Headset Prices
Q1: What is the average cost of a decent headset?
A1: A decent headset usually varies from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200, depending on the functions and brand. Standard designs may use less than ideal sound quality, while mid-range alternatives frequently supply a good balance between price and performance.
Q2: Are more expensive headsets worth the financial investment?
A2: More expensive designs often come with exceptional sound quality, much better convenience, and advanced functions such as sound cancellation and high-quality microphones. For severe users, such as gamers or audio specialists, the investment can be worth it.
Q3: Do wireless headsets cost more than wired ones?
A3: Generally, yes, due to the added innovation associated with wireless Bluetooth connections. Nevertheless, the price difference can likewise depend on brand reputation and additional features.
Q4: Are there any budget plan options that offer good quality?
A4: Yes, there are numerous budget plan choices that provide good quality, especially from emerging brand names. Customers ought to try to find models with good evaluations and important functions that suit their needs.
Q5: What should I consider before purchasing a headset?
A5: Consider aspects such as use purpose (video gaming, travel, or office), convenience, audio quality, microphone efficiency, battery life (for wireless), and obviously, budget plan constraints.
